UNPKG

@redocly/theme

Version:

Shared UI components lib

95 lines 15.4 kB
"use strict"; var __importDefault = (this && this.__importDefault) || function (mod) { return (mod && mod.__esModule) ? mod : { "default": mod }; }; Object.defineProperty(exports, "__esModule", { value: true }); exports.GeminiIcon = void 0; const react_1 = __importDefault(require("react")); const styled_components_1 = __importDefault(require("styled-components")); const Icon = (props) => (react_1.default.createElement("svg", Object.assign({ viewBox: "0 0 14 14", fill: "none", xmlns: "http://www.w3.org/2000/svg" }, props), react_1.default.createElement("g", { clipPath: "url(#clip0_5333_7017)" }, react_1.default.createElement("mask", { id: "mask0_5333_7017", style: { maskType: 'alpha' }, maskUnits: "userSpaceOnUse", x: "0", y: "0", width: "14", height: "14" }, react_1.default.createElement("path", { d: "M6.98858 0.876221C7.11667 0.876221 7.22837 0.96381 7.25964 1.08813C7.3552 1.46837 7.48112 1.84033 7.63618 2.20043C8.04154 3.14225 8.59778 3.96654 9.30396 4.67271C10.0105 5.37908 10.8346 5.93532 11.7763 6.34069C12.1364 6.4957 12.5085 6.62162 12.8887 6.71723C13.0131 6.7485 13.1005 6.86001 13.1005 6.9881C13.1005 7.11618 13.0131 7.22788 12.8885 7.25915C12.5083 7.35471 12.1363 7.48063 11.7763 7.63569C10.8344 8.04106 10.0103 8.5973 9.30396 9.30348C8.59778 10.01 8.04154 10.8341 7.63618 11.7758C7.48109 12.1359 7.35511 12.508 7.25945 12.8882C7.24431 12.9487 7.20945 13.0023 7.16038 13.0406C7.11132 13.079 7.05086 13.0999 6.98858 13.1C6.8605 13.1 6.74898 13.0126 6.71772 12.8881C6.62209 12.5078 6.49611 12.1359 6.34099 11.7758C5.93581 10.8339 5.37976 10.0098 4.6732 9.30348C3.96684 8.5973 3.14274 8.04106 2.20091 7.63569C1.8408 7.48062 1.46885 7.35464 1.08862 7.25896C1.02821 7.24387 0.974561 7.20905 0.936177 7.16002C0.897792 7.11099 0.876864 7.05055 0.876709 6.98828C0.876709 6.8602 0.964299 6.74868 1.08862 6.71742C1.46887 6.6218 1.84082 6.49582 2.20091 6.34069C3.14274 5.93551 3.96702 5.37927 4.6732 4.6729C5.37957 3.96672 5.93581 3.14244 6.34117 2.20061C6.49619 1.8405 6.62211 1.46854 6.71772 1.08832C6.73278 1.02784 6.76762 0.97413 6.81669 0.935705C6.86576 0.89728 6.92626 0.876345 6.98858 0.876221Z", fill: "black" }), react_1.default.createElement("path", { d: "M6.98858 0.876221C7.11667 0.876221 7.22837 0.96381 7.25964 1.08813C7.3552 1.46837 7.48112 1.84033 7.63618 2.20043C8.04154 3.14225 8.59778 3.96654 9.30396 4.67271C10.0105 5.37908 10.8346 5.93532 11.7763 6.34069C12.1364 6.4957 12.5085 6.62162 12.8887 6.71723C13.0131 6.7485 13.1005 6.86001 13.1005 6.9881C13.1005 7.11618 13.0131 7.22788 12.8885 7.25915C12.5083 7.35471 12.1363 7.48063 11.7763 7.63569C10.8344 8.04106 10.0103 8.5973 9.30396 9.30348C8.59778 10.01 8.04154 10.8341 7.63618 11.7758C7.48109 12.1359 7.35511 12.508 7.25945 12.8882C7.24431 12.9487 7.20945 13.0023 7.16038 13.0406C7.11132 13.079 7.05086 13.0999 6.98858 13.1C6.8605 13.1 6.74898 13.0126 6.71772 12.8881C6.62209 12.5078 6.49611 12.1359 6.34099 11.7758C5.93581 10.8339 5.37976 10.0098 4.6732 9.30348C3.96684 8.5973 3.14274 8.04106 2.20091 7.63569C1.8408 7.48062 1.46885 7.35464 1.08862 7.25896C1.02821 7.24387 0.974561 7.20905 0.936177 7.16002C0.897792 7.11099 0.876864 7.05055 0.876709 6.98828C0.876709 6.8602 0.964299 6.74868 1.08862 6.71742C1.46887 6.6218 1.84082 6.49582 2.20091 6.34069C3.14274 5.93551 3.96702 5.37927 4.6732 4.6729C5.37957 3.96672 5.93581 3.14244 6.34117 2.20061C6.49619 1.8405 6.62211 1.46854 6.71772 1.08832C6.73278 1.02784 6.76762 0.97413 6.81669 0.935705C6.86576 0.89728 6.92626 0.876345 6.98858 0.876221Z", fill: "url(#paint0_linear_5333_7017)" })), react_1.default.createElement("g", { mask: "url(#mask0_5333_7017)" }, react_1.default.createElement("g", { filter: "url(#filter0_f_5333_7017)" }, react_1.default.createElement("path", { d: "M-0.227015 10.4326C1.18534 10.9342 2.80867 9.99369 3.39882 8.33193C3.98897 6.67037 3.32234 4.91669 1.90998 4.41507C0.497625 3.91346 -1.1257 4.85396 -1.71604 6.51553C-2.306 8.17729 -1.63937 9.93096 -0.227015 10.4326Z", fill: "#FFE432" })), react_1.default.createElement("g", { filter: "url(#filter1_f_5333_7017)" }, react_1.default.createElement("path", { d: "M6.04409 4.95442C7.98425 4.95442 9.55728 3.34672 9.55728 1.3638C9.55728 -0.619301 7.98443 -2.22681 6.04409 -2.22681C4.10374 -2.22681 2.53052 -0.619113 2.53052 1.3638C2.53052 3.34672 4.10355 4.95442 6.04409 4.95442Z", fill: "#FC413D" })), react_1.default.createElement("g", { filter: "url(#filter2_f_5333_7017)" }, react_1.default.createElement("path", { d: "M4.67843 16.4367C6.70392 16.3378 8.24192 14.1304 8.11364 11.5065C7.98556 8.88254 6.23941 6.83558 4.21393 6.93466C2.18844 7.03374 0.650439 9.241 0.778715 11.8649C0.906992 14.4888 2.65295 16.5358 4.67843 16.4367Z", fill: "#00B95C" })), react_1.default.createElement("g", { filter: "url(#filter3_f_5333_7017)" }, react_1.default.createElement("path", { d: "M4.67843 16.4367C6.70392 16.3378 8.24192 14.1304 8.11364 11.5065C7.98556 8.88254 6.23941 6.83558 4.21393 6.93466C2.18844 7.03374 0.650439 9.241 0.778715 11.8649C0.906992 14.4888 2.65295 16.5358 4.67843 16.4367Z", fill: "#00B95C" })), react_1.default.createElement("g", { filter: "url(#filter4_f_5333_7017)" }, react_1.default.createElement("path", { d: "M6.70714 14.8494C8.40506 13.8162 8.85958 11.4634 7.72223 9.59402C6.58489 7.7245 4.28627 7.04658 2.58816 8.07957C0.890051 9.11294 0.435527 11.4658 1.57287 13.3353C2.7106 15.2047 5.00903 15.8826 6.70714 14.8494Z", fill: "#00B95C" })), react_1.default.createElement("g", { filter: "url(#filter5_f_5333_7017)" }, react_1.default.createElement("path", { d: "M13.5707 8.97502C15.4792 8.97502 17.0265 7.48505 17.0265 5.64736C17.0265 3.80949 15.4792 2.31952 13.5707 2.31952C11.6622 2.31952 10.115 3.80949 10.115 5.64736C10.115 7.48524 11.6622 8.97502 13.5707 8.97502Z", fill: "#3186FF" })), react_1.default.createElement("g", { filter: "url(#filter6_f_5333_7017)" }, react_1.default.createElement("path", { d: "M-1.5844 8.58873C0.17304 9.92499 2.74027 9.50587 4.1498 7.65218C5.55933 5.79867 5.27754 3.2126 3.5201 1.87634C1.76265 0.539895 -0.804385 0.959007 -2.21411 2.81271C-3.62364 4.66622 -3.34166 7.25247 -1.5844 8.58873Z", fill: "#FBBC04" })), react_1.default.createElement("g", { filter: "url(#filter7_f_5333_7017)" }, react_1.default.createElement("path", { d: "M7.42033 10.5639C9.51777 12.006 12.2982 11.6044 13.6303 9.66653C14.9626 7.72883 14.3422 4.98906 12.2445 3.54694C10.1469 2.10444 7.36664 2.50641 6.03434 4.44393C4.70222 6.38183 5.32251 9.12159 7.42014 10.5639H7.42033Z", fill: "#3186FF" })), react_1.default.createElement("g", { filter: "url(#filter8_f_5333_7017)" }, react_1.default.createElement("path", { d: "M11.2336 0.436156C11.7673 1.16174 11.0814 2.57221 9.70202 3.58694C8.32243 4.60166 6.77163 4.83598 6.23799 4.11059C5.70435 3.38482 6.39 1.97416 7.76939 0.959622C9.14898 -0.0550994 10.7 -0.289425 11.2334 0.435968L11.2336 0.436156Z", fill: "#749BFF" })), react_1.default.createElement("g", { filter: "url(#filter9_f_5333_7017)" }, react_1.default.createElement("path", { d: "M6.85291 3.9097C8.98633 1.93074 9.7185 -0.748558 8.48848 -2.07465C7.25846 -3.40074 4.53169 -2.87181 2.39827 -0.892846C0.264845 1.08612 -0.467518 3.76542 0.762693 5.09151C1.99272 6.41759 4.71949 5.88867 6.85291 3.9097Z", fill: "#FC413D" })), react_1.default.createElement("g", { filter: "url(#filter10_f_5333_7017)" }, react_1.default.createElement("path", { d: "M2.47959 11.0173C3.74766 11.9248 5.20334 12.0627 5.73114 11.3254C6.25894 10.588 5.65881 9.25455 4.39074 8.34701C3.12285 7.43947 1.66698 7.30159 1.13937 8.03885C0.611574 8.77629 1.21152 10.1097 2.47959 11.0173Z", fill: "#FFEE48" })))), react_1.default.createElement("defs", null, react_1.default.createElement("filter", { id: "filter0_f_5333_7017", x: "-2.85766", y: "3.3534", width: "7.39819", height: "8.14086", filterUnits: "userSpaceOnUse", colorInterpolationFilters: "sRGB" }, react_1.default.createElement("feFlood", { floodOpacity: "0", result: "BackgroundImageFix" }), react_1.default.createElement("feBlend", { mode: "normal", in: "SourceGraphic", in2: "BackgroundImageFix", result: "shape" }), react_1.default.createElement("feGaussianBlur", { stdDeviation: "0.463378", result: "effect1_foregroundBlur_5333_7017" })), react_1.default.createElement("filter", { id: "filter1_f_5333_7017", x: "-1.94918", y: "-6.7065", width: "15.9862", height: "16.1406", filterUnits: "userSpaceOnUse", colorInterpolationFilters: "sRGB" }, react_1.default.createElement("feFlood", { floodOpacity: "0", result: "BackgroundImageFix" }), react_1.default.createElement("feBlend", { mode: "normal", in: "SourceGraphic", in2: "BackgroundImageFix", result: "shape" }), react_1.default.createElement("feGaussianBlur", { stdDeviation: "2.23985", result: "effect1_foregroundBlur_5333_7017" })), react_1.default.createElement("filter", { id: "filter2_f_5333_7017", x: "-3.03712", y: "3.12285", width: "14.9666", height: "17.1257", filterUnits: "userSpaceOnUse", colorInterpolationFilters: "sRGB" }, react_1.default.createElement("feFlood", { floodOpacity: "0", result: "BackgroundImageFix" }), react_1.default.createElement("feBlend", { mode: "normal", in: "SourceGraphic", in2: "BackgroundImageFix", result: "shape" }), react_1.default.createElement("feGaussianBlur", { stdDeviation: "1.90418", result: "effect1_foregroundBlur_5333_7017" })), react_1.default.createElement("filter", { id: "filter3_f_5333_7017", x: "-3.03712", y: "3.12285", width: "14.9666", height: "17.1257", filterUnits: "userSpaceOnUse", colorInterpolationFilters: "sRGB" }, react_1.default.createElement("feFlood", { floodOpacity: "0", result: "BackgroundImageFix" }), react_1.default.createElement("feBlend", { mode: "normal", in: "SourceGraphic", in2: "BackgroundImageFix", result: "shape" }), react_1.default.createElement("feGaussianBlur", { stdDeviation: "1.90418", result: "effect1_foregroundBlur_5333_7017" })), react_1.default.createElement("filter", { id: "filter4_f_5333_7017", x: "-2.86183", y: "3.78807", width: "15.0188", height: "15.3529", filterUnits: "userSpaceOnUse", colorInterpolationFilters: "sRGB" }, react_1.default.createElement("feFlood", { floodOpacity: "0", result: "BackgroundImageFix" }), react_1.default.createElement("feBlend", { mode: "normal", in: "SourceGraphic", in2: "BackgroundImageFix", result: "shape" }), react_1.default.createElement("feGaussianBlur", { stdDeviation: "1.90418", result: "effect1_foregroundBlur_5333_7017" })), react_1.default.createElement("filter", { id: "filter5_f_5333_7017", x: "6.49612", y: "-1.29935", width: "14.1491", height: "13.8932", filterUnits: "userSpaceOnUse", colorInterpolationFilters: "sRGB" }, react_1.default.createElement("feFlood", { floodOpacity: "0", result: "BackgroundImageFix" }), react_1.default.createElement("feBlend", { mode: "normal", in: "SourceGraphic", in2: "BackgroundImageFix", result: "shape" }), react_1.default.createElement("feGaussianBlur", { stdDeviation: "1.80943", result: "effect1_foregroundBlur_5333_7017" })), react_1.default.createElement("filter", { id: "filter6_f_5333_7017", x: "-6.39114", y: "-2.1852", width: "14.7181", height: "14.8353", filterUnits: "userSpaceOnUse", colorInterpolationFilters: "sRGB" }, react_1.default.createElement("feFlood", { floodOpacity: "0", result: "BackgroundImageFix" }), react_1.default.createElement("feBlend", { mode: "normal", in: "SourceGraphic", in2: "BackgroundImageFix", result: "shape" }), react_1.default.createElement("feGaussianBlur", { stdDeviation: "1.6399", result: "effect1_foregroundBlur_5333_7017" })), react_1.default.createElement("filter", { id: "filter7_f_5333_7017", x: "2.40345", y: "-0.247677", width: "14.8579", height: "14.606", filterUnits: "userSpaceOnUse", colorInterpolationFilters: "sRGB" }, react_1.default.createElement("feFlood", { floodOpacity: "0", result: "BackgroundImageFix" }), react_1.default.createElement("feBlend", { mode: "normal", in: "SourceGraphic", in2: "BackgroundImageFix", result: "shape" }), react_1.default.createElement("feGaussianBlur", { stdDeviation: "1.46454", result: "effect1_foregroundBlur_5333_7017" })), react_1.default.createElement("filter", { id: "filter8_f_5333_7017", x: "3.43598", y: "-2.60638", width: "10.5997", height: "9.75933", filterUnits: "userSpaceOnUse", colorInterpolationFilters: "sRGB" }, react_1.default.createElement("feFlood", { floodOpacity: "0", result: "BackgroundImageFix" }), react_1.default.createElement("feBlend", { mode: "normal", in: "SourceGraphic", in2: "BackgroundImageFix", result: "shape" }), react_1.default.createElement("feGaussianBlur", { stdDeviation: "1.31045", result: "effect1_foregroundBlur_5333_7017" })), react_1.default.createElement("filter", { id: "filter9_f_5333_7017", x: "-2.04789", y: "-5.01896", width: "13.3468", height: "13.0548", filterUnits: "userSpaceOnUse", colorInterpolationFilters: "sRGB" }, react_1.default.createElement("feFlood", { floodOpacity: "0", result: "BackgroundImageFix" }), react_1.default.createElement("feBlend", { mode: "normal", in: "SourceGraphic", in2: "BackgroundImageFix", result: "shape" }), react_1.default.createElement("feGaussianBlur", { stdDeviation: "1.10683", result: "effect1_foregroundBlur_5333_7017" })), react_1.default.createElement("filter", { id: "filter10_f_5333_7017", x: "-1.7922", y: "4.82486", width: "10.455", height: "9.71453", filterUnits: "userSpaceOnUse", colorInterpolationFilters: "sRGB" }, react_1.default.createElement("feFlood", { floodOpacity: "0", result: "BackgroundImageFix" }), react_1.default.createElement("feBlend", { mode: "normal", in: "SourceGraphic", in2: "BackgroundImageFix", result: "shape" }), react_1.default.createElement("feGaussianBlur", { stdDeviation: "1.36998", result: "effect1_foregroundBlur_5333_7017" })), react_1.default.createElement("linearGradient", { id: "paint0_linear_5333_7017", x1: "4.35148", y1: "9.05502", x2: "10.7005", y2: "3.70245", gradientUnits: "userSpaceOnUse" }, react_1.default.createElement("stop", { stopColor: "#4893FC" }), react_1.default.createElement("stop", { offset: "0.27", stopColor: "#4893FC" }), react_1.default.createElement("stop", { offset: "0.777", stopColor: "#969DFF" }), react_1.default.createElement("stop", { offset: "1", stopColor: "#BD99FE" })), react_1.default.createElement("clipPath", { id: "clip0_5333_7017" }, react_1.default.createElement("rect", { width: "14", height: "14", fill: "white" }))))); exports.GeminiIcon = (0, styled_components_1.default)(Icon).attrs(() => ({ 'data-component-name': 'icons/GeminiIcon/GeminiIcon', })) ` height: ${({ size }) => size || '16px'}; width: ${({ size }) => size || '16px'}; `; //# sourceMappingURL=GeminiIcon.js.map